Module: BenefitsDocuments
- Defined in:
- lib/lighthouse/benefits_documents/form526/polled_document_failure_handler.rb,
lib/lighthouse/benefits_documents/service.rb,
lib/lighthouse/benefits_documents/configuration.rb,
lib/lighthouse/benefits_documents/worker_service.rb,
lib/lighthouse/benefits_documents/form526/upload_status_updater.rb,
lib/lighthouse/benefits_documents/form526/update_documents_status_service.rb,
lib/lighthouse/benefits_documents/form526/documents_status_polling_service.rb,
lib/lighthouse/benefits_documents/form526/upload_supplemental_document_service.rb
Overview
Form 526 specific client service for the Lighthouse Benefits Documents API: dev-developer.va.gov/explore/api/benefits-documents/docs?version=current
There is a similar service implemented in lib/lighthouse/benefits_documents/service.rb, however, its functionality is closely tied to the claims status tool.
Uploads the supplied document metadata to the POST /services/benefits-documents/v1/documents Lighthouse endpoint
Defined Under Namespace
Modules: Form526 Classes: Configuration, Service, WorkerService